How much do shell operator j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for shell operator in Alvin, TX is $16.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.70 and $18.03 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Shell Operators?

Shell Operators are professionals responsible for managing and controlling operations related to the production and processing of oil, gas, or other materials in facilities such as refineries, chemical plants, or oil rigs. They monitor equipment, ensure safety protocols are followed, and adjust controls to regulate flow, pressure, and temperature. Shell Operators are also tasked with routine inspections, troubleshooting equipment issues, and reporting any malfunctions to maintenance teams. Their role is critical to maintaining efficient and safe production processes.

What is the difference between Shell Operator vs Drilling Rig Operator?

AspectShell OperatorDrilling Rig Operator
CredentialsHigh school diploma, safety certifications, technical trainingHigh school diploma, safety certifications, technical training
Work EnvironmentOffshore platforms, refineries, oil production sitesOffshore drilling rigs, onshore drilling sites
Industry UsageOil and gas extraction, refining companiesOil and gas extraction, drilling contractors
Job FocusOperating equipment, monitoring production, safety complianceOperating drilling machinery, managing drilling operations

Both Shell Operators and Drilling Rig Operators work in the oil and gas industry, often offshore or on drilling sites. While Shell Operators focus on operating equipment and monitoring production processes, Drilling Rig Operators specialize in managing drilling machinery and procedures. Both roles require safety certifications and technical training, but their specific tasks and work environments differ slightly, reflecting their distinct responsibilities within the industry.
